female yorkie 7 month old I have a female yorkie 7 and half months old and has not come in heat yet is this normal I heard they come in heat around 6 months old |
It depends. It could be much later. Are you going to have her spayed? |
Proberly Not |
It varies from dog to dog. Some don't even come in heat until they are 12 to 14 months old. |
